Transaction 255a88da3037f12f696d6acd5de37ec085af751d265f1b3d98cec3131ee3946f
1 Input
2 Outputs
- 255a88da3037f12f696d6acd5de37ec085af751d265f1b3d98cec3131ee3946f:0
- 255a88da3037f12f696d6acd5de37ec085af751d265f1b3d98cec3131ee3946f:1
value 60000000
address 1CD3X7rbRxd8YDhXJCbTm6R5jaRArHELjp
value 225399679
address 1P2gHQS55zYbgkTdVfvLhdPpjaBeXVwyMG